Niacin (Vitamin B3)
Niacin contributes to normal functioning of the nervous system, to normal psychological function, to the maintenance of normal mucous membranes, to the maintenance of normal skin

Vitamin C
Vitamin C contributes to the normal function of the immune system, to the protection of cells from oxidative stress, to normal collagen formation for the normal function of blood vessels, to normal collagen formation for the normal function of bones, cartilage, gum, teeth, skin and to the reduction of tiredness and fatigue

Vitamin B6 (Pyridoxin)
Vitamin B6 contributes to normal red blood cell formation, to the regulation of hormonal activity, to the normal function of the immune system, to normal protein and glycogen metabolism, to normal functioning of the nervous system and to normal psychological function

Riboflavin (Vitamin B2)
Riboflavin contributes to the maintenance of normal mucous membranes, to normal energy-yielding metabolism, to the maintenance of normal vision, to the maintenance of normal red blood cells, to the protection of cells from oxidative stress.

Thiamine (Vitamin B1)
Thiamine contributes to normal psychological function, to normal functioning of the nervous system and to the normal function of the heart
